Ryan Quigley was born in Derry, Northern Ireland, and moved to Glasgow
when still very young.
Over the last few years Ryan has become one of the most in demand
trumpet players in Scotland, performing with the likes of Bob Geldof, Ronan Keating, The Hothouse Flowers, The Bad Plus, Stacey Kent, The Royal Scottish National Orchestra, The Scottish Chamber Orchestra,
BBC Scottish Symphony Orchestra, RTE Symphony and Concert Orchestras and The Commitments to name but a few.
Ryan is currently lead trumpet with the Scottish National Jazz Orchestra
and regularly tours at home and abroad with Salsa Celtica and others.
Also becoming more active as a composer and arranger, Ryan is currently
writing material for his debut jazz album.
